Caretaker Minister of Information, Ziad Makary, stressed that the security of the airport is under the control of the Lebanese army, adding that there are arrangements that the state can adopt to protect the key facilities from the Israeli attacks. Interviewed by MTV channel, Makary saw no signs of an imminent election of a president of the republic under the current circumstances. 'Some call for electing a president before a ceasefire,' he said, adding, 'For me, I see that the logic says that ceasefire is a priority before anything else.' Moreover, Makary said that 'Hezbollah's military machine is still ongoing following the killing of the party chief,' but he called Hezbollah to release more statements with further details about the operations. Furthermore, Makary hailed the internal solidarity with the displaced and the national unity that have been prevailing since over a million people left their homes. 'The Lebanese youth defending the land are now our sole backbone and we are counting on them,' he said. About the presidential file, Makary said that the 'legitimate president is the one who gathers the Lebanese and has the ability to communicate with all sides, internally and externally.' 'I believe Sleiman Frangieh is capable of playing this role,' he underlined. Source: National news agency - Lebanon
